How syncing works
Connect a source once. Adduce keeps it current and tells you when it can't.
- Scheduled and on demand
- Daily scheduled syncs, plus a manual sync whenever you want one.
- Incremental
- Cursors mean each pull picks up exactly where the last one ended — no re-reading what Adduce has already seen.
- Crash-safe
- Syncs run as durable steps and resume after a failure. A stuck sync recovers itself within two hours.
- Failures explained
- When a sync fails, an AI diagnostician classifies why — expired auth, rate limit, provider outage — in plain language, with the fix.
Read where it reads. Write only when you ask.
- Data in
- Sources are pulled, never written to. Adduce holds read credentials and nothing else, and you can disconnect any source at any time.
- Data out
- Destinations only receive what you send them: an issue you chose to file, an event on an endpoint you added. There is no background write.
